Why do high intensity interval training (HIIT)? Why not?! You can exercise for less time (compared to steady state), but get awesome calorie torching benefits. Because you are having to push yourself really hard with short amounts of recovery, you burn more calories in less time. You work in the anaerobic zone. Anaerobic means without oxygen. While you are breathing, you are working so hard that your body is having to pull energy from other parts of your body to keep it going. That’s why it is an effective fat burner.
